Ensuring environmental sanitation and people's awareness are still decisive factors

Minh Hạnh |

Hanoi has issued many plans to tighten environmental sanitation during holidays and Tet, but the situation of littering and indiscriminate dumping still occurs in many places.

Although the city has implemented many solutions to ensure environmental sanitation and build a green - clean - beautiful city, in reality, there is still a situation of littering and indiscriminate dumping taking place in many places.

In order to maintain a clean, beautiful, and civilized urban appearance during the 2026 New Year and Binh Ngo Lunar New Year, Hanoi City People's Committee has issued Plan No. 355/KH-UBND dated December 20, 2025, requesting to strengthen management and maintain environmental sanitation throughout the area during peak times. Accordingly, Hanoi City sets a goal to ensure a clean, beautiful, and safe urban environment, serving the needs of living, traveling, and playing of people and tourists; and proactively prevent and prevent the risk of pollution arising from living, producing, and doing business activities.

However, in some areas, especially the suburbs, the situation of littering and burning indiscriminately still occurs, causing environmental pollution and urban unsightliness. On roads such as Pham Tu, Phuc La, the Tien Phuong dike area... although local authorities have installed signs prohibiting littering, accompanied by clear penalties, garbage is still dumped indiscriminately right at the foot of the ban sign.

Along with that, in many suburban areas, domestic waste and construction waste are accumulated for a long time, causing serious environmental pollution. Notably, construction materials such as sand and gravel are scattered all over the road surface; every time vehicles circulate, they are swept away by dusty dust, posing a potential risk of traffic unsafety.

Not only in the suburban area, but also in the center of the Capital, the pressure of garbage during holidays and Tet also increases. After each crowded event, many streets fall into a situation of being filled with garbage. Cans, plastic bottles, plastic cups, styrofoam boxes for food, nylon bags are thrown scattered on the road, on sidewalks and in tree beds, making the urban space become messy, in contrast to the image of a civilized and elegant Capital that Hanoi is aiming for.

According to Mr. Nguyen Tri Luong (in Tan My, Tu Liem ward), every time the My Dinh Stadium area organizes an event, the situation of littering indiscriminately recurs. “After the event ends, the square area in front of My Dinh Stadium is often flooded with garbage. Many people calmly throw plastic cups, straws, and cake crusts right under their feet. Small actions but when combined have created'mountains of garbage' in just one night,” Mr. Luong shared.

In Plan No. 355/KH-UBND, the Hanoi People's Committee requests to strengthen supervision, inspection and strictly handle violations of environmental sanitation, especially at "hot spots" for illegal dumping of garbage and construction waste; transport vehicles that spill soil, sand, and garbage water onto the road. Maintaining environmental discipline during Tet is identified as an important factor contributing to building a civilized and elegant image of the Capital.

Sharing with reporters, Ms. Ninh Thi Loan (environmental sanitation worker in charge of Hoan Kiem Lake area) said that what sanitation workers most desire is still respect and awareness of the people. According to Ms. Loan, the main reason for the rampant waste situation stems from the awareness of a part of the people. "If people are not conscious, the task of sweeping and collecting is just the tip of the iceberg. To solve it at the root, it is necessary for the grassroots government to drastically intervene in propaganda, reminders, and at the same time strictly handle acts of littering and indiscriminate discharge," Ms. Loan said.

Reality shows that if there is no synchronous coordination from local authorities and the joint efforts of the community, no matter how hard the environmental sanitation force tries, the waste situation will still be difficult to thoroughly solve. Strict handling of violations, from illegal dumping of construction waste to littering in public places, needs to be carried out regularly and continuously, avoiding the situation of "hot above, cold below" or just being a movement during peak periods.
